Transaction 7af4bc802b81876e8882632e71f02e3cf9cf86ad8a6e9dfa5c2fc60fbfe70634

1 Input
2 Outputs
  • 7af4bc802b81876e8882632e71f02e3cf9cf86ad8a6e9dfa5c2fc60fbfe70634:0
  • value  1684501
    address  3AHULarh2BV6dK72L2wsMhPyZrRF4uWLMF
  • 7af4bc802b81876e8882632e71f02e3cf9cf86ad8a6e9dfa5c2fc60fbfe70634:1
  • value  264047969
    address  1Lr6KZbffFo1GLnmogc6VUrLb6Gw1t1Edf